[Order Now]( Handmade in Maine North Country Wind Bells® is based in Round Pond, where they craft wind bells that echo the familiar tones of coastal and harbor bells. Inspired by his time as lobsterman, founder Jim Davidson sought to recreate the distinctive sounds he heard at sea. He designed each bell to match the sounds of the New England coast, and named them accordingly.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
